The present invention aims at efficient recycling of construction wastes, and is an invention for removing foreign matters mixed in recycled aggregates and selected soils (hereinafter referred to as "fine aggregates") during the construction waste treatment process.

The foreign material removal method is to put aggregate or sedimentary soil together with water into the aeration tank after crushing to obtain fine aggregates from construction waste. And only fine aggregate remains. Subsequently, a screw decanter is used to separate and sort water, foreign matter and fine particles, and discharge them to different outlets to be transported to the yard, and the water is transferred to a water storage tank and resupply. It is about providing the configuration and method.

The present invention having the above configuration has the advantage that it is possible to easily separate and recover fine aggregates by particle size separation of the circulating aggregate physically, the separated aggregates can be recycled to the aggregate of construction sites.

Therefore, the proper management of these wastes enables the actual recycling, minimizing environmental pollution, replacing scarce resources, and reducing costs throughout the construction industry.
On the other hand, in Korean Patent Application Publication No. 10-2007-019780, which the applicant has applied for, the aeration filtration tank is composed of a first tank and a second tank, so that the aeration and separation are established. In the present invention, the first aeration filtration tank and the second aeration are set. The filter tank was integrated into one to make it more convenient.
In the existing invention, after the separation process by aeration and stirring for 20 minutes in the first aeration filtration tank, the aeration and separation in the second aeration filtration tank for 20 minutes and pumped with a decanter and inclined screen for final separation. The final sedimentation process took one hour. However, in the present invention, the foreign matter and clay silt during the process of aeration separation for 20 minutes in the aeration filtration tank, so that the aeration and separation in one aeration filtration tank at the same time for the purpose of reducing the time delay in each aeration filtration tank The sewage was transported to the decanter to operate the separation process within the time during which the aeration filtration tank was operated, thereby reducing the required time by 1/2 or more.

The lower body of the aeration filtration tank 100 is a double cylindrical tank having an outer tank 121 and the inner tank 113, the inner tank 113 inserted therein is cylindrical, having a separate outlet function at the bottom Form.
When the screening soil or fine aggregates to be washed and separated is put into the outer tank 121 of the aeration filtration tank 100 due to the vortices caused by the aeration pressure generated by immersion by the washing water supplied from the storage water tank 300 Residual foreign matter and small particles with a light specific gravity will rise. At this time, the small particulates to the inner filtration wall 111 of the inner tank 113 is transferred to the screw decanter 200 together with the water supplied to the washing water. Therefore, the drain pipe configured in the inner tank 113 should be installed to be connected to the screw decanter 200. That is, the upper portion of the inner tank 113 is installed in the center of the aeration filter tank 100 is the inner filtration wall 111 is installed using a rigid support 112, the lower portion of the inner tank 113 is aeration filtration Pass through the bottom of the water tank 100 to be connected to the screw decanter 200, but should be a pipe form of the material that can withstand the frictional force and pressure caused by the movement of the aggregate and water.
Outer water tank 121 is aeration device 123 is installed to allow the separation of floating by the aeration in the sediment or fine aggregates introduced into the lower and side.
That is, the aeration device 123 is installed on the side and bottom surface of the outer tank 121 of the aeration tank 100, is supplied from the air supply pipe 122 for supplying air to be sprayed in the water at a constant pressure . The air supply pipe 122 is installed in a multi-stage type to wrap around the aeration tank 100. In addition, the aeration device 123 is installed at a portion in contact with water corresponding to the inner surface of the air supply pipe 122. In addition, the aeration device 123 of the side portion is installed to have a constant inclination so that water flows in the clockwise direction in the water, the aeration device 123 of the bottom portion 124 is installed upward.

또한, 외측수조(121)의 배수구조는 외측여과벽체(101)를 거쳐 여과되는 이물질 슬러리가 테두리형집배수관로(130)로 집수되고, 테두리형집배수관로(130)는 바닥부(131)가 5도 이상의 경사를 갖고 물 흐름이 자연스럽도록 배출구 방향으로 기울어진다. 여기서, 테두리형집배수관로(130)는 폭기여과수조(100)에 공급되는 세척수와 폭기장치(123)에 의한 폭기압에 의하여 외측여과벽체(101)을 통과한 물과 이물질, 점토, 실트 등이 원심력에 의하여 튀지 않도록 적정 높이를 설정하여야 설치하여야 한다. In addition, the drainage structure of the outer tank 121 is the foreign matter slurry filtered through the outer filtration wall 101 is collected in the rim-type collection drainage pipe 130, the bottom of the rim-type drainage pipe 130 is 5 It is inclined in the direction of the outlet so that the water flow is natural with a slope of more than degrees. Here, the frame-type drainage pipe 130 is the water and foreign matter, clay, silt, etc. that passed through the outer filtration wall 101 by the aeration pressure by the washing water and the aeration device 123 is supplied to the aeration filtration tank (100) Proper height should be set to prevent splashing by centrifugal force.

내측여과벽체(111)와 외측여과벽체(101)의 체 크기는 가로 0.3mm, 세로 100mm의 직사각형 망을 구성하여 폭이 좁고 길이가 긴 이물질의 여과배출이 원활하도록 한다. 내측여과벽체(111)와 외측여과벽체(101)를 안팎으로 설치하는 목적은 세척 분리 공정을 단축하기 위함이다. 또한, 수압에 의한 여과벽체의 파손을 방지하기 위하여 일정 간격마다 지지대(102),(112)를 설치한다.The sieve size of the inner filtration wall 111 and the outer filtration wall 101 forms a rectangular network of 0.3 mm in width and 100 mm in length to facilitate the filtration and discharge of foreign materials having a narrow and long length. The purpose of installing the inner filtration wall 111 and the outer filtration wall 101 in and out is to shorten the washing separation process. In addition, in order to prevent breakage of the filtration wall due to water pressure, supports 102 and 112 are provided at regular intervals.

The bottom portion 124 of the aeration filtration tank 100 is inclined toward the outlet 125 at an intermediate point and has a function of inducing a smooth flow when discharging the remaining selected sediment or circulating aggregate. That is, when the bottom 124 is based on the two outlets 125, such as "~", the portion adjacent to the outlet is concave, the middle point is convex, and the adjacent portion that meets the outlet 125 again is It becomes concave.
The bottom part 124 of the aeration filtration tank 100 has an inclination in the direction of the outlet 125 from the middle point is that the bottom of the aeration filtration tank 100 is convex and concave like a wave shape, the supplied washing water The flow of clay is not uniformly formed, and the clay lumps are more finely dispersed by the air pressure sprayed from the side and the lower surface while the particles flow up and down.
